It was a collaboration project with Hodinkee and while it sold out immediately, views among the watch nerd world seem to be a little mixed on it I think because of the collaboration with Hodinkee. While I'm not the worlds biggest fan of the dink at the moment, I picked it up as I thought it was fairly fetching (at least to my eye) with the gray 24 hour bezel, and provides a fair amount of value (workhorse Swiss Sellita Sw330-2 movement, decent size proportions, included both a cordovan two-piece strap and nylon NATO strap, and what I think is becoming a uniquely Unimatic design ethos) for $1,300.00 USD. So far it's been a pretty enjoyable watch to own and not one I really worry about being stolen or damaged while traveling (which was my goal when purchasing).
